The Porsche 997.2 GT3 is considered by many enthusiasts to be one of the finest GT3 generations ever produced. Powered by the legendary 3.8-litre naturally aspirated Mezger engine, delivering 435 hp to the rear wheels through a 6-speed manual gearbox, it offers a pure and engaging driving experience that has become rare.
